J2EE 框架 FleXive
openkk
13年前
FleXive是一个基于EJB3标准并且整合了JSF组件库,灵活且扩展性高的java EE 5的程序包(library)。它重点关注于企业级web应用,并全面支持通过jsf来显示和操纵企业规模级的数据存储和查询。 你可以在现有的java EE应用中添加FleXive,在此基础上扩充新的应用,或者把FleXive单独作为java EE的框架以此来开发新的应用。
FleXive框架主要特点的包括:
*数据类型到关系数据库表的动态O/R映射
*内容处理
*国际化(数据和用户界面)
*版本/历史
*安全使用存取控制清单(ACL)管理角色/组/用户和数据(类型,例如,工作流程和财产的权限)
*工作流
*支持脚本语言
*在一个虚拟的树型文件系统中管理你的数据
*强大的类SQL语言的查询引擎
*缓存
*支持委托人(mandator)模式
Flexive框架是具有LGPL 2.1 许可的开源框架。Flexive还附带一个建立在web框架上可选的后台应用,可以帮助你直观地管理后台维护中的大多数方面,包括定义数据结构,建立查询,管理用户和安全等。
FxContent co = EJBLookup.getContentEngine().initialize("Product"); co.setValue("/name", FxLanguage.ENGLISH, "SuperTronics LCD TV"); co.setValue("/price", 799.0); co.save();